1. How to use lights when pulling over on road?

A. turn on the hazard lights

B. turn on the right-turn signal in advance

C. use the high and low beam lights alternately

D. not need to use any light to indicate

Answer: B

2. A motorized vehicle driver who does not hang the license plate is subject to a ________.

A. 6-point penalty

B. 12-point penalty

C. 2-point penalty

D. 3-point penalty

Answer: B

3. If a motorized vehicle driver causes a traffic accident and runs away but his conduct does not constitute a crime, he is subject to a 12-point penalty.

Answer: Y

4. A driver can park the vehicle by borrowing the sidewalk if he cannot find the parking area.

Answer: N

5. When encountering an overflowing bridge, the driver should look at the situation, and passes through slowly before he makes sure that it is safe to do so.

Answer: Y

6. A motorized vehicle driver who violates of traffic lights is subject to a 6-point penalty.

Answer: Y

7. A motorized vehicle runs on the road without a label of insurance, the traffic police can detain the vehicle license according to law.

Answer: N

8. A motorized vehicle driver who uses falsified and altered vehicle license is subject to a ________.

A. 6-point penalty

B. 3-point penalty

C. 2-point penalty

D. 12-point penalty

Answer: D

9. When encountering stopping in turn or slow-moving vehicles in front at an intersection where lanes are reduced, the motorized vehicle should _________.

A. enter the intersection from road shoulder by the right side of the vehicle in front

B. enter the intersection from the side of interspace

C. pass alternately with one vehicle each lane to enter the intersection

D. change to left lane and cut in to enter the intersection

Answer: C

10. A motorized vehicle driver who escapes or commits other extremely serious acts after causing a major accident in violation of the traffic regulations is subject to a prison term of more than 7 years.

Answer: N

11. Which of the following vehicle in front in the same lane is not allowed to be overtaken?

A. police car on duty

B. large bus or large truck

C. taxis

D. public bus

Answer: A

12. When crossing each other at night, how far should change the high beam lights to low beam lights?

A. not need to change lights

B. beyond 150m

C. within 100m

D. within 50m

Answer: B

13. A person can not apply the motorized vehicle driving license, if he has been held for criminal liabilities according to law because of driving after drinking and causing a major traffic accident.

Answer: Y

14. If a motorized vehicle driver has caused a major accident in violation of the traffic regulations which has caused serious injury, the driver is subject to a prison term of less than 3 years or a criminal detention.

Answer: Y

15. If a person escapes after causing a traffic accident and constitutes a crime, his driving license should be revoked and he is banned _____ from re-obtaining a driving license.

A. within 5 years

B. within 10 years

C. within 20 years

D. for lifetime

Answer: D

16. When a motorized vehicle causes a minor traffic accident and obstructs traffic flow, it does not need to move.

Answer: N

17. If a motorized vehicle driver chases and races while driving on road, commits serious acts, the driver is subject to a prison term of less than 3 years.

Answer: N

18. Driving in a dusty weather, it does not needed to turn on the head light, the contour light and the tail light.

Answer: N

19. May not turn on the turn signal when overtaking.

Answer: N

20. If a motorized vehicle driver has caused a major accident in violation of the traffic regulations which has caused heavy loss to public or private property, the driver is subject to________.

A. a prison term of more than 3 years

B. a prison term of less than 3 years or a criminal detention

C. a prison term of 3 ~ 7 years

D. a prison term of more than 5 years

Answer: B
